Narwhal Labs Laser Material and Settings Library
A library of known materials and laser settings that have been tested to work at Narwhal Labs on a Thunder Laser Nova 35 100W CO2 Laser Cutter and Engraver. Settings are not guaranteed to work and should be considered a baseline. Please add to or update this page if you test a new known material. Please obey all safety protocols listed on our main laser information page.
Never Ever Cut These Things
| Material | Also Known As | Reason |
| PVC | Poly Vinyl Chloride, Sintra, Oracal Vinyl, Pleather | Emits deadly chlorine gas, corrodes machine internals |
| Rubber | Smells like a tire fire. Potential cyanide gas. | |
| Polypropylene | Melty plastic mess | |
| Carbon Plate | Melty mess | |
| Unknown | Anything you don't know the composition of | Risk of fire, damage, injury or death. |
Wood
| Material | Thickness | Cut/Fill/Image | Power (%) | Speed (mm/s) | Passes | Notes |
| Ozark Trail Tumbler | NA | Image | 40 | 300 | 1 | Requires clean up |
| Baltic Birch Plywood | 6mm | Fill | 25 | 100 | 1 | Dark/deep image. Can dial back. |
| Baltic Birch Plywood | 6mm | Line | 60 | 15 | 2 | Mostly cut through with some areas that need to be trimmed with a razor |
| Baltic Birch Plywood | 6mm | Line | 20 | 200 | 1 | Good quality line engraving |
| Baltic Birch Plywood | 9 | Line | 95 | 10 | 1 | Should be a complete cut with proper focus. Work piece should be a few mm closer to the cutting head than auto focus distance. |
| Glass | NA | Fill | 20 | 300 | 1 | Shallow engraving, clear image |
| Glass | NA | 50 | 800 | 1 | Shallow engraving, clear image | |
| Paper Micarta | 4.45mm | Cut | 60 | 15 | 1 | Complete cut. Residue at cut edge can be cleaned easily with acetone / alcohol mix. |
